Output 8e809c1ae9f76531ff5f39629f3f6fe1bfeb786e44c32ab95e9c46216baa5abd:3

value
155995768
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8dad1a658403d20a96ffc0062e50a60bceab1106 OP_EQUAL
address
MLpGstmNzTjMCmdtyAJ9rk3J6aWpuBaaxp
transaction
8e809c1ae9f76531ff5f39629f3f6fe1bfeb786e44c32ab95e9c46216baa5abd
spent
true